The Secret's Out - Nottingham Welcomes Stealth
Stealth is the brainchild of James Baillie (The Bomb, The Social) and George and Sean Akins (Rock City), its mission statement simply being "to prove to the doubters that there's plenty of life left in dance music."
Whilst the emphasis may be on dance music, the 680-capacity venue will see the introduction of a weekly NME night (every Thursday), where resident DJs Queens Of Noize, Punish The Atom's Joey Bell and the Home Taping Is Killing Music DJs will man the decks alongside performances from some of the hottest signed and unsigned live bands around.
Fridays will see Stealth host such renowned club nights as Detonate, Spectrum and Manuva Manuva, while Saturday nights will be served by the self-titled Stealth night alongside such established clubs as Bugged Out and Tyrant.
